Sentrex Wind Services Inc. is a leading service provider to the commercial wind energy industry.We are based in Quispamsis, New Brunswick area and we work throughout Canada. We install and maintain tall test towers for wind measurement (met towers), we provide remote sensing wind measurement services (SoDAR and LiDAR) and we provide off-grid power supplies for remote sites.We are currently seeking a technician for field and shop work. The job is suited for a person who cares about doing a job right; has a strong aptitude for troubleshooting, repair, fabrication and assembly; has solid computer skills; can work alone or with a team; is willing and able to travel; can prepare detailed field reports; and, enjoys both office and field work. If you cannot travel or do not want to travel, please do NOT apply.Duties of the successful candidate will include building of mobile, low voltage power supplies for off-grid use, incorporating solar, small diesel, fuel cells and/or micro wind. Duties will also include installation of off-grid power supplies, and LiDAR units and SoDAR units throughout Canada; monitoring, troubleshooting and repair work; installing and configuring other wind measurement equipment including data logging and communications. On the job training will be provided for the right candidate.Prior experience in welding, fabrication, carpentry, panel wiring, electronics and electrical work or a combination of these would be an asset. Travel to remote sites will require candidate to operate 4WD pickups pulling trailers (on road and off road) and operate ATV's and snowmobiles.Wages will be commensurate with skills level.Mandatory:
